Output e9a68dcd8bd673ee332c7298ed10cf63ce64d2f11d3532190332b0de7c715f12:1

value
5400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89056f40851c1820c0e81a72243b2893e06f354 OP_EQUAL
address
3MS6nsgQPJPWTysnAueffjEB9rip6dkLrx
transaction
e9a68dcd8bd673ee332c7298ed10cf63ce64d2f11d3532190332b0de7c715f12
confirmations
133270
spent
true